Channel 2

Channel 2 (Hebrew: ערוץ 2‎) is an Israeli commercial television channel that started broadcasting in November 4, 1993 under the Second Israeli Broadcasting Authority. It has two current concessionaires: Keshet and Reshet, who divide the week schedule between them. One of the original concessionaries for Channel 2 was Telad, which during the renewal process was left out. The channel is the most popular and attracts millions of viewers every week.
